Summary
The applicant proposes turning a detached outbuilding into an annexe linked to Mill House. A dormer window is also proposed on the side of the outbuilding.
The site is in protected countryside near three businesses at the same postcode. No property fronts within the surveyed area have a direct view of the site, while 15 are screened by buildings.
The work could change how the outbuilding looks and is used. The council may check that the annexe stays linked to the main home.

What the council wrote
Conversion of detached outbuilding to ancillary annexe and side dormer
